    Tribute to NYPD Sergeant Michael Curtin – E.O.W. 9/11/01

    Today, we honor the memory of NYPD Sergeant Michael Curtin, who tragically lost his life on September 11, 2001, while serving in the line of duty. As a squad sergeant for Truck Company 2 of the Police Department’s Emergency Service Unit (ESU), Michael Curtin was a man whose career was marked by bravery, dedication, and an unwavering commitment to public service.

    Always Ready and Thinking

    Sergeant Curtin was known for his ability to adapt to any high-risk rescue operation, no matter how unpredictable or dangerous. Whether it was water recoveries, auto extractions, or talking down deranged gunmen or distraught individuals, Curtin was always prepared. He excelled in tasks that many others would shy away from, including cajoling jilted lovers away from the edge of the George Washington Bridge.

    His calm demeanor and preparedness in these critical situations made him a natural leader. As a former Marine who served in the Gulf War, Curtin’s experience shaped him into a quick-thinking, level-headed figure, ready to tackle any challenge head-on. His colleagues in the ESU often relied on his leadership, and they admired his ability to think on his feet and remain composed under pressure.

    A Commitment to Training

    Sergeant Curtin’s belief in being always ready extended beyond emergency calls. On Sundays or during slower days when there were fewer emergencies, he took the time to drill his team, ensuring they were constantly honing their skills. His squad members never sat idle; Curtin would teach them new techniques, such as how to wire a police van by tapping into a telephone pole.

    “He was always thinking on his feet and wanted you to think on your feet, too,” said Robert Yaeger, an officer with Truck 2. “If you wanted an epitome of an E cop, that would be Michael Curtin.”

    A Warm Heart Beneath the Tough Exterior

    While Sergeant Curtin’s dedication to his job was unwavering, he also had a personal side that made him beloved among his colleagues. After each Sunday morning training session, Curtin would cook a hearty Marine Corps breakfast for his squad, featuring sloppy eggs, sausage, and bacon seasoned with his favorite red, blue, and green spices. This personal touch added warmth to his leadership and was a reminder of the importance of camaraderie in his team.

    A Devoted Family Man

    Sergeant Curtin was not just a dedicated officer; he was also a devoted family man. At 45, he was a father of three athletic teenage daughters, and his love for his family was evident to all who knew him. On September 11, 2001, Sergeant Curtin had planned to return home to his kitchen in Medford, N.Y., to prepare a birthday dinner for his wife, Helga. Tragically, he never made it back.

    Remembering a Hero

    Michael Curtin’s passing on 9/11 was a heartbreaking loss, not only to his family and colleagues but to the entire city of New York. He was a true hero, embodying the spirit of sacrifice, dedication, and resilience. Sergeant Curtin’s legacy lives on through the lives he saved, the people he inspired, and the memories of a man who always put others first.

    We remember Sergeant Michael Curtin not just for his bravery in the face of danger, but for his kindness, his leadership, and the love he shared with his family and community. His heroism will never be forgotten.

    Closing Line

    This tribute serves as a reminder of Sergeant Michael Curtin’s enduring legacy of service, both in uniform and at home. May we continue to honor his memory by embodying the values he stood for.
